example_closure with an integer, well get an error. This means accessing the length of a list is a linear operation: we need to traverse the whole list in order to figure out its size. It takes one argument: a closure without any arguments that returns a value T By following the help text's which weve done here with String the first time. extremely popular, theres a chance the maintainers dont know about or use Strings in Elixir are represented internally by contiguous sequences of bytes known as binaries: We can also get the number of bytes in a string: Notice that the number of bytes in that string is 6, even though it has 5 graphemes. We use this list to populate the .gitignore template choosers available We dont use the closure again after the closure WebData Types. implement one, two, or all three of these Fn traits, in an additive fashion, tool, and any additional templates should be mentioned in a comment in the at the root) but helps maintainers support older versions still in the wild. All lists must conform to a set of rules of construction and formatting. Each node stores a piece of data and a reference to its next and/or previous node. After more than twenty years, Questia is discontinuing operations as of Monday, December 21, 2020. Strings are text (sequences of characters) including punctuation, symbols, and whitespace. Elixir supports true and false as booleans: Elixir provides a bunch of predicate functions to check for a value type. folder that best suits where it belongs. The